"""this module contains a set of functions to create astng trees from scratch
(build_* functions) or from living object (object_build_* functions)
:author: Sylvain Thenault
:copyright: 2003-2009 LOGILAB S.A. (Paris, FRANCE)
:contact: http://www.logilab.fr/ -- mailto:python-projects@logilab.org
:copyright: 2003-2009 Sylvain Thenault
:contact: mailto:thenault@gmail.com
"""
__docformat__ = "restructuredtext en"
import sys
from inspect import getargspec
from logilab.astng import nodes
def _attach_local_node(parent, node, name):
node.name = name # needed by add_local_node
parent.add_local_node(node)
_marker = object()
def attach_dummy_node(node, name, object=_marker):
"""create a dummy node and register it in the locals of the given
node with the specified name
"""
enode = nodes.EmptyNode()
enode.object = object
_attach_local_node(node, enode, name)
nodes.EmptyNode.has_underlying_object = lambda self: self.object is not _marker
def attach_const_node(node, name, value):
"""create a Const node and register it in the locals of the given
node with the specified name
"""
if not name in node.special_attributes:
_attach_local_node(node, nodes.const_factory(value), name)
def attach_import_node(node, modname, membername):
"""create a From node and register it in the locals of the given
node with the specified name
"""
from_node = nodes.From(modname, [(membername, None)])
_attach_local_node(node, from_node, membername)
def build_module(name, doc=None):
"""create and initialize a astng Module node"""
node = nodes.Module()
node.doc = doc
node.name = name
node.pure_python = False
node.package = False
node.parent = None
return node
def build_class(name, basenames=(), doc=None):
"""create and initialize a astng Class node"""
node = nodes.Class()
node.body = []
node.name = name
node.bases = []
for base in basenames:
basenode = nodes.Name()
basenode.name = base
node.bases.append(basenode)
basenode.parent = node
node.doc = doc
node.locals = {}
node.instance_attrs = {}
return node
def build_function(name, args=None, defaults=None, flag=0, doc=None):
"""create and initialize a astng Function node"""
args, defaults = args or [], defaults or []
# first argument is now a list of decorators
func = nodes.Function()
func.decorators = None
func.body = []
func.name = name
func.args = argsnode = nodes.Arguments()
argsnode.args = []
for arg in args:
argsnode.args.append(nodes.Name())
argsnode.args[-1].name = arg
argsnode.args[-1].parent = argsnode
argsnode.defaults = []
for default in defaults:
argsnode.defaults.append(nodes.const_factory(default))
argsnode.defaults[-1].parent = argsnode
argsnode.kwarg = None
argsnode.vararg = None
argsnode.parent = func
func.doc = doc
func.locals = {}
if args:
register_arguments(func)
return func
# def build_name_assign(name, value):
# """create and initialize an astng Assign for a name assignment"""
# return nodes.Assign([nodes.AssName(name, 'OP_ASSIGN')], nodes.Const(value))
# def build_attr_assign(name, value, attr='self'):
# """create and initialize an astng Assign for an attribute assignment"""
# return nodes.Assign([nodes.AssAttr(nodes.Name(attr), name, 'OP_ASSIGN')],
# nodes.Const(value))
def build_from_import(fromname, names):
"""create and initialize an astng From import statement"""
return nodes.From(fromname, [(name, None) for name in names])
def register_arguments(func, args=None):
"""add given arguments to local
args is a list that may contains nested lists
(i.e. def func(a, (b, c, d)): ...)
"""
if args is None:
args = func.args.args
if func.args.vararg:
func.set_local(func.args.vararg, func.args)
if func.args.kwarg:
func.set_local(func.args.kwarg, func.args)
for arg in args:
if isinstance(arg, nodes.Name):
func.set_local(arg.id, arg)
else:
register_arguments(func, arg.elts)
def object_build_class(node, member, localname):
"""create astng for a living class object"""
basenames = [base.__name__ for base in member.__bases__]
return _base_class_object_build(node, member, basenames,
localname=localname)
def object_build_function(node, member, localname):
"""create astng for a living function object"""
args, varargs, varkw, defaults = getargspec(member)
if varargs is not None:
args.append(varargs)
if varkw is not None:
args.append(varkw)
func = build_function(getattr(member, '__name__', None) or localname, args,
defaults, member.func_code.co_flags, member.__doc__)
node.add_local_node(func, localname)
def object_build_datadescriptor(node, member, name):
"""create astng for a living data descriptor object"""
return _base_class_object_build(node, member, [], name)
def object_build_methoddescriptor(node, member, localname):
"""create astng for a living method descriptor object"""
# FIXME get arguments ?
func = build_function(getattr(member, '__name__', None) or localname,
doc=member.__doc__)
# set node's arguments to None to notice that we have no information, not
# and empty argument list
func.args.args = None
node.add_local_node(func, localname)
def _base_class_object_build(node, member, basenames, name=None, localname=None):
"""create astng for a living class object, with a given set of base names
(e.g. ancestors)
"""
klass = build_class(name or getattr(member, '__name__', None) or localname,
basenames, member.__doc__)
klass._newstyle = isinstance(member, type)
node.add_local_node(klass, localname)
try:
# limit the instantiation trick since it's too dangerous
# (such as infinite test execution...)
# this at least resolves common case such as Exception.args,
# OSError.errno
if issubclass(member, Exception):
instdict = member().__dict__
else:
raise TypeError
except:
pass
else:
for name, obj in instdict.items():
valnode = nodes.EmptyNode()
valnode.object = obj
valnode.parent = klass
valnode.lineno = 1
klass.instance_attrs[name] = [valnode]
return klass
__all__ = ('register_arguments', 'build_module',
'object_build_class', 'object_build_function',
'object_build_datadescriptor', 'object_build_methoddescriptor',
'attach_dummy_node',
'attach_const_node', 'attach_import_node')
